Leavenworth, WA – Ultimate Christmastown
Every winter, the Bavarian-themed town of Leavenworth becomes a picturesque Christmas scene filled with lights, snow, carolers, and Santa! Thousands of visitors from all over come to Leavenworth every winter to experience the incredible display of holiday lights and a plethora of fun winter activities. See below for some of our favorite winter-themed activities in … [Read more…]